Imagination: The Alchemy of Reality and Possibility
Imagination, a multifaceted human faculty, is the ability to form new mental images, concepts, and sensations, transcending the bounds of immediate perception and experience. It is a powerful force that enables us to explore uncharted territories of thought, create new worlds, and forge unique interpretations of reality.
The essence of imagination lies in the capacity to combine existing knowledge and sensory input into novel configurations. It involves the manipulation of memories, emotions, and abstract concepts to construct internal representations that extend beyond the physical limitations of the present moment. This process can range from the playful creation of fantastical scenarios to the deliberate construction of intricate solutions to complex problems.
Imagination plays a crucial role in shaping our understanding of the world. It allows us to predict future events, envision alternative possibilities, and generate creative solutions to challenges. By drawing upon our imagination, we can step outside of the confines of our immediate experience and explore a vast realm of possibilities.
Types of Imagination:
Fantasy: This form of imagination involves creating fantastical scenarios, characters, and worlds that defy the laws of nature and logic.
It is a powerful tool for escapism, entertainment, and exploring the unknown.
Creative Imagination: This is the ability to generate new ideas and concepts, often leading to the creation of art, literature, music, and innovation. It involves a blend of inspiration, intuition, and deliberate experimentation.
Empathy: The capacity to understand and share the emotions of others, even if we have not experienced them ourselves, relies on imagination. By putting ourselves in another’s shoes, we can access a deeper understanding of their thoughts, feelings, and motivations.
Practical Imagination: This form of imagination is crucial for problem-solving, decision-making, and navigating everyday life. It involves visualizing potential outcomes, anticipating consequences, and finding creative solutions to challenges.
Imagination in Action:
Art and Literature: Artists and writers use their imaginations to create captivating stories, vibrant paintings, and mesmerizing music. Their creations transport us to new worlds, awaken our emotions, and offer unique perspectives on the human condition.
Science and Technology: Imagination is essential for scientific discovery and technological advancement. Scientists must imagine novel hypotheses, while engineers visualize and design innovative solutions to complex problems.
Personal Growth: Imagination allows us to envision our ideal selves, set ambitious goals, and develop strategies for achieving them. It empowers us to overcome limitations, embrace new possibilities, and find meaning in our lives.
